Adaptation
The process by which organisms adjust to changes in their environment to survive and reproduce, and also a term used in psychology to describe how individuals adjust to new information or experiences.
Permanent Change
An alteration in state or condition that is lasting and does not revert back to its previous state.
Pavlov
A Russian physiologist known for his discovery of classical conditioning during his experiments on the digestive systems of dogs.
Nobel Prize
An international recognition awarded annually in several categories such as Physics, Chemistry, Medicine, Literature, Peace, and Economic Sciences, for outstanding contributions in these fields.
